Several promotions and training dojos have cut ties with Davey Richards.

 

[UPDATE] Davey Richards sent in a statement and retired from wrestling. You can read it HERE

Team Ambition, the wrestling school out of St Louis, Missouri, has tweeted out that they have parted ways with head trainer Davey Richards. In a statement posted on Twitter, Team Ambition state, “the decision has been made for Team Ambition to formally and permanently part ways with Davey Richards.” Team Ambition member Camaro Jackson tweeted, “Looking forward to the future. Thank you all for your continued support!”

Yesterday, St Louis Anarchy announced that Richards is off their April 14th event. He was originally scheduled to face Derek Neal for the Gateway Heritage Championship. We reached out to St Louis Anarchy directly and they replied, “Davey was fired for a Anarchy code of conduct violation.”

Earlier today Prestige Wrestling tweeted that effective immediately they have cut ties with Richards. He was scheduled to compete at their “Nervous Breakdown” event on March 31st in Los Angeles.

Since, Richards has deleted his Twitter account. This comes after allegations of domestic abuse. We will give updates on this story.
